Gadolinium Enhancement in Intracranial Atherosclerotic Plaque and Ischemic Stroke: A Systematic Review and Meta‐Analysis

Abstract: BackgroundGadolinium enhancement on high‐resolution magnetic resonance imaging (MRI) has been proposed as a marker of inflammation and instability in intracranial atherosclerotic plaque. We performed a systematic review and meta‐analysis to summarize the association between intracranial atherosclerotic plaque enhancement and acute ischemic stroke.Methods and ResultsWe searched the medical literature to identify studies of patients undergoing intracranial vessel wall MRI for evaluation of intracranial atheroscl… Show more

“…A systematic review and meta-analysis to evaluate the association between abnormal plaque enhancement on high-resolution MRI and acute ischemic stroke has been performed [25]. The results indicate that intracranial plaque enhancement on high-resolution vessel wall MRI is strongly associated with ischemic stroke.…”
